About 24 Sea Road
24 Sea Road is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Abergele (LL22 7BU). It has a recorded floor area of 172 m² (around 1851 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(March 2018) shows an E (score 53),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. When first surveyed in November 2008 the rating was F,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good and main heating went from Average to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 75), a 2-band jump. The property has an EV charger on record, all of which lower running costs and tend to lift resale appeal. Other recorded features include a balcony and notable views.
At 172 m² the property is well over the postcode median (99 m² across 20 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 85% of similar EPCs). 4 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 3 is the typical count. Across 2010–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 3.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£264,000 is 10% above the 2023 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£130/sq ft) was about 30.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: September 2023 at £240,000.
